The Human Side of Family
Service, a slide presentation,
will be highlighted at the an-
nual meeting of the Jewish
Family Service and Resettle-
ment Service at 7:45 p.m. Wed-
nesday at Cong. Beth Abraham
Hillel Moses, announces Marvin
C. Daitch, president. -
Guest speaker will be author
Stephen Birmingham. He will
speak on "A Non-Jew Looks at
the Jewish Family — Past, Pre-
sent and Future."
The meeting will be the occa-
sion to mark the 60th anniver-
sary of the JFS. Past presidents
will be honored.
Officers and board members
will be elected.
The chairman of the nominat-
ing committee for Jewish Fam-
ily Service is Helen Shevin,
immediate past president; Max
Sosin is chairperson of the
nominating committee for Re-
settlement Service. Members of
the Jewish Family Service
nominating committee are: Mar-
jory Ansell, Albert Colman,
John E. Jacobs, Sylvia Jaffe, Ai-
leen Kleiman, Edith Resnick.
Members of the Resettlement
Service nominating committee
are: Judith Cantor, Anne Cap-
lan, Pauline Grossman, George
Tarnoff. Agnes Klein and Sha-
ron Taylor are co-chairmen of
the annual meeting planning
committee.
Ellen Labes, community edu-
cation coordinator, invites the
public to this fre -e lecture.
